SoundManager报告错误

时间:2011-06-10 19:35:14

标签: java android soundpool

在我的应用报告中关闭了力量

  

java.lang.ClassCastException:int []无法强制转换为java.lang.ref.WeakReference   在android.media.SoundPool.postEventFromNative(SoundPool.java:466)   在dalvik.system.NativeStart.run(原生方法)

Soundpool由我创建的Soundmanager类包装,静态使用,即:

    SoundManager.getInstance();
    SoundManager.initSounds(this, mApp.Sound(), mApp.Voice());
    SoundManager.loadSounds();

...

SoundManager.playSound(SoundManager.SNDGAMEOVER, 1);

...

我的主要活动和另一个活动之间发生错误 - 不确定是否在第二个活动的一个实例正在关闭或正在打开时。它很难调试,因为它间歇性。有没有其他人遇到过类似的问题?

0 个答案:

没有答案